PVR Inox Limited has scheduled its 31st Annual General Meeting (AGM) for Friday, September 11, 2026, at 11:00 am. The meeting will be conducted through Video Conferencing or Other Audio Visual Means (VC/OAVM) in accordance with the Companies Act, 2013 and relevant SEBI Listing Regulations.

Meeting Logistics

The company informed the National Stock Exchange of India Limited and BSE Limited that the notice of the AGM and the Annual Report for FY26 would be sent electronically to members whose email addresses are registered as on August 14, 2026. Physical copies of the documents have been dispensed with, though they remain available upon request via email to the company secretary or the Registrar and Transfer Agent.

Shareholders holding shares as on the cut-off date of September 4, 2026, are eligible to exercise their voting rights. The company has engaged NSDL e-Governance Infrastructure Limited to provide remote e-voting facilities. Members can also attend the meeting live or view the webcast at the designated NSDL portal.

For shareholders without registered email IDs, the company has issued a separate intimation under Regulation 36(1)(b) of SEBI (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015. This communication provides the web-link and QR code to access the complete Annual Report for Financial Year 2025-26 on the company’s website and stock exchange portals.

Voting Procedures

Voting will be conducted exclusively by electronic means. Key procedural details include:

  • Remote e-voting is available for members holding shares on the record date.
  • Members who have not cast their vote remotely may do so during the AGM via the e-voting system.
  • Participation in the AGM is restricted to VC/OAVM; physical presence is not permitted.
  • Members attending via VC/OAVM will be counted toward the quorum under Section 103 of the Companies Act, 2013.

The specific timeline for remote e-voting is as follows:

Event Date and Time
Commencement of remote e-voting Monday, September 7, 2026 at 9:00 am
End of remote e-voting Thursday, September 10, 2026 at 5:00 pm

The notice of the AGM and the annual report are accessible on the company website, stock exchange portals, and the NSDL e-voting platform. Shareholders without registered email addresses have been instructed to update their details with the company or their Depository Participant to receive access links and QR codes.

AGM Agenda Items

The AGM will transact both ordinary and special businesses. The ordinary business includes the adoption of audited standalone and consolidated financial statements for FY26. Additionally, the meeting will consider the reappointment of two directors retiring by rotation:

  • Ms. Renuka Ramnath (DIN: 00147182)
  • Mr. Ajay Kumar Bijli (DIN: 00531142)

Under special business, shareholders will approve the remuneration for three independent directors for FY26. Each director is set to receive ₹18,00,000.

Director Name DIN Remuneration (FY26)
Vishesh Chander Chandiok 00016112 ₹18,00,000
Dinesh Kanabar 00003252 ₹18,00,000
Shishir Baijal 00089265 ₹18,00,000

The resolutions require ordinary majority approval pursuant to Sections 149, 197, and 198 of the Companies Act, 2013.

PVR Inox has issued an appeal to its shareholders to register or update their email addresses with the company, its Registrar and Transfer Agent (RTA), or their respective Depository Participants (DPs). The request aims to ensure investors receive the notice for the upcoming Annual General Meeting (AGM) and the Annual Report for FY26 electronically. This initiative seeks to enhance stakeholder communication and support environmental sustainability by reducing paper usage.

Shareholder Action Required

Shareholders holding shares in dematerialized form are requested to update their email addresses with their relevant Depository Participant. National Securities Depository Limited (NSDL) provides a facility for this registration via its e-services portal at https://eservices.nsdl.com/kyc-attributes/#/login . Members holding physical shares who have not yet registered an email address must submit Form ISR-1 along with supporting documents to KFIN Technologies Limited (Kfintech), the company's RTA.

Submission Methods for Physical Shareholders

Physical shareholders can submit the ISR-1 form through three distinct channels:

Method Procedure
In Person Verification (IPV) An authorized person from the RTA verifies original documents and retains copies with IPV stamping.
Hard Copies Self-attested documents can be mailed to Kfintech’s Hyderabad office.
Electronic Mode Forms can be submitted digitally using e-signature via the Kfintech portal.

The physical address for hard copy submissions is Selenium Building, Tower-B, Plot No. 31 & 32, Financial District, Nanakramguda, Serilingampally, Hyderabad – 500 032, Telangana.

KYC Updates and Contact Details

The company also reminded shareholders holding physical shares to update other key KYC details, including PAN, bank account information, and mobile numbers, with Kfintech if they have not done so already. Shareholders who have already registered their email addresses are advised to keep them validated with their DPs or RTA to ensure uninterrupted electronic servicing of communications.

For queries, shareholders may contact the company at cosec@pvrinox.com or the RTA at inward.ris@kfintech.com . Detailed FAQs regarding ISR forms are available on the Kfintech website.
